Bathroom Remodel Cost in San Diego, CA — 2026 Guide

A mid-range bathroom remodel in San Diego runs $24,000–$41,000 in 2026 — approximately 25% above the national average. San Diego's premium coastal real estate market, high cost of living, robust renovation demand, and California's complex permitting environment all contribute to renovation costs substantially above the national average.

Average Bathroom Remodel Cost in San Diego

Based on local contractor quotes and 2026 RSMeans regional pricing data

Basic
$15,000–$24,000

Vanity and fixture replacement, toilet upgrade, basic tile refresh, new accessories

Mid-Range ✓ Most Common
$24,000–$41,000

Full tile renovation, new vanity and fixtures, shower replacement with glass, updated lighting

High-End
$41,000–$58,000+

Full gut renovation, custom tile, frameless glass, freestanding tub, outdoor shower connection, layout change

San Diego Regional Cost Index: 1.25x national average

San Diego bathroom renovation costs run approximately 25% above the national average — among California's highest after San Francisco and Los Angeles, driven by strong renovation demand, high cost of living, and robust coastal real estate market.

What Drives Bathroom Remodel Costs in San Diego

Cost Factor Impact Notes
Labor — San Diego metro rates High San Diego tile setters and plumbers run $64–$98/hr burdened — elevated by California's high cost of living and strong residential renovation demand.
California Contractors State License Board (CSLB) Low California requires CSLB licensing for all contractor work over $500. Verify any San Diego contractor's CSLB license at cslb.ca.gov before signing a contract.
Permit fees — San Diego County / City of San Diego Medium San Diego bathroom permits: $350–$1,200. Development Services Department processing: 4–8 weeks.
Coastal environment considerations Medium Coastal San Diego neighborhoods (Pacific Beach, La Jolla, Ocean Beach, Coronado) have salt air and humidity. Specify marine-grade fixtures and premium caulk rated for coastal conditions.
Tariff material impact High Material tariffs add approximately $1,600–$3,000 to mid-range San Diego bathroom budgets.

San Diego Bathroom Renovation — Coastal California Specifics

San Diego's renovation market reflects its dual character: a premium coastal California city with world-class real estate, and a large military-adjacent metro with diverse housing stock across a wide geographic area.

**Coastal vs. inland pricing**: San Diego's most popular coastal neighborhoods (La Jolla, Pacific Beach, Mission Hills, Coronado, Del Mar) are uniformly premium renovation markets. Inland areas (El Cajon, Santee, Chula Vista, Eastlake) run 10–15% below coastal San Diego pricing for comparable scope, while still being above the national average.

**Outdoor shower connections**: San Diego's climate makes indoor-outdoor bathroom connections (outdoor shower access from master bath) a common renovation request. Outdoor shower rough-in adds $2,000–$5,000 depending on plumbing access. Full outdoor shower enclosure: $4,000–$12,000.

**HOA considerations**: San Diego's condo and HOA community density is high. For HOA-governed properties (including many La Jolla and Mission Valley communities), confirm HOA renovation approval requirements before signing a contractor agreement. Requirements typically include contractor insurance certificates, approved contractor lists in some communities, and pre-construction walkthrough.

Frequently Asked Questions — Bathroom Remodel in San Diego

How much does a bathroom remodel cost in San Diego in 2026?

A mid-range bathroom remodel in San Diego, CA costs $24,000–$41,000 in 2026. Basic updates run $15,000–$24,000. Full custom renovations cost $41,000–$58,000+. San Diego is approximately 25% above the national average.

How does San Diego compare to Los Angeles for bathroom renovation costs?

San Diego runs slightly below Los Angeles for comparable bathroom renovation scope — approximately 25% above national average versus Los Angeles at 28–32% above. The difference reflects Los Angeles's larger labor market premium. For San Diego homeowners, costs are meaningfully lower than LA but still among California's highest.
